Judge Brett Kavanaugh will appear before the Senate Judiciary Committee Tuesday morning to answer questions on the road to his confirmation as the next U.S. Supreme Court justice.
With over 300 opinions authored as a D.C. circuit judge, Kavanaugh’s record is the most substantial of any nominee in recent history.
The hearing is scheduled to begin at 9:30 a.m. ET.
